# Functions
NewEventsPreProcessorV0 will create a new events data preprocessor instance.
NewEventsPreProcessorV1 will create a new events data preprocessor instance.
# Variables
ErrNilBlockData signals that a nil block data has been provided.
ErrNilHeaderGasConsumption signals that a nil header gas consumption has been provided.
ErrNilTransactionPool signals that a nil transaction pool has been provided.
# Structs
ArgsEventsPreProcessor defines the arguments needed to create a new events data preprocessor.
# Interfaces
EmptyBlockCreatorContainer defines the behavior of an empty block creator container.